Start using Adobe Acrobat Sign on Vinkius019d7547adobe agreement members
Checks all signers, approvers, and CC recipients on an agreement to show their specific roles and current signing status.
019d7547adobe audit trail
Retrieves the legally binding record of every action taken on a document, including timestamps and IP addresses.
019d7547adobe cancel agreement
Stops an active signing process permanently if terms change or the deal falls through. This action is irreversible.
019d7547adobe create agreement
Starts a new e-signature agreement workflow, sending out contracts and NDAs to specified parties.
019d7547adobe get agreement
Pulls all metadata for one specific agreement by ID, including full participant sets and document details.
019d7547adobe list agreements
Generates an overview of your entire contract pipeline, showing the name, status (drafted, signed, etc.), and sender for multiple agreements.
019d7547adobe list library documents
Lists reusable templates or forms that you can reference when setting up a new agreement.
019d7547adobe search agreements
Searches across your agreements by name or keywords to locate specific documents in the pipeline quickly.
019d7547adobe send reminder
Sends a follow-up email nudge to all participants who still need to sign an agreement that is currently pending.
019d7547adobe upload document
Uploads a document file first, creating a transient ID required as the initial step before sending out any signature request.

The Tradeoffs
Trying to search by document ID alone.
A user might just guess a file name or use an incomplete identifier in a simple search. This only returns partial data and misses the full context of who was involved.
→
For a complete picture, first run adobe_list_agreements to see all pipeline statuses. Then, if you need specifics on one contract, use adobe_get_agreement with the ID found in the list.
Sending a contract without preparing the file.
A user tries to create an agreement and attach a raw document that hasn't been processed by Adobe Sign first. This fails because the system needs a dedicated reference ID.
→
Remember this sequence: Always run adobe_upload_document first. The resulting ID must then be used when calling adobe_create_agreement.

Common Questions About Adobe Acrobat Sign MCP
How do I get started with Adobe Sign? +
Subscribe, then enter your Adobe Sign access token (from Adobe Admin Console → Acrobat Sign → API → Integration Key). Your AI agent connects instantly to the global v6 API. No code, no complex setup — just connect and start signing.
Can my AI agent send a contract for signature to multiple people? +
Yes. Upload a document, then create an agreement with multiple signers in a specific order. Adobe Sign handles the sequential signing flow — Signer 1 gets notified first, then Signer 2 after completion, and so on. Your agent tracks each signer's progress in real time.
What if a signer hasn't signed yet — can I send a reminder? +
Just tell your agent "send a reminder for the Acme NDA." It sends an email reminder to all pending signers with an optional custom message. No tab-switching, no logging into Adobe Sign — your agent handles it directly from your conversation.
Can I access the legal audit trail for compliance? +
Yes. Every signed agreement has a tamper-proof audit trail showing exactly when it was created, viewed, signed, and by whom — with timestamps and IP addresses. Perfect for legal departments, regulated industries, and any business that needs proof of signing for compliance.
How do I check all my outstanding contracts or agreements using the `adobe_list_agreements` tool? +
It returns a list of every agreement, showing its current status (DRAFT, SIGNED, OUT_FOR_SIGNATURE) and key dates. This gives you an immediate overview of your entire document pipeline without needing specific IDs.
If I need to stop a contract that is currently out for signature, how do I use the `adobe_cancel_agreement` tool? +
It immediately halts the signing process and notifies all involved parties. Be careful: this action is irreversible, so you must create a brand new agreement if you change the terms.
I have an Agreement ID; how do I get every participant's role and deep status using `adobe_get_agreement`? +
It provides complete details for that specific agreement, listing all participants, their roles (like APPROVER or DELEGATE), and comprehensive metadata. This is useful when the list view isn't detailed enough.
Where can I find reusable templates? How do I check available forms with `adobe_list_library_documents`? +
This tool lists all your company's pre-built agreements and document templates. It gives you the name and ID for these documents, which you reference when creating a new contract.
